The tangent (tan) formula identity states that the tangent of an angle (θ) is equal to the sine of that angle divided by the cosine of that angle. This is a fundamental trigonometric identity.
Here's a breakdown:
-
The Formula:
tan θ = sin θ / cos θ
-
Explanation:
tan θ
represents the tangent of the angle θ.sin θ
represents the sine of the angle θ.cos θ
represents the cosine of the angle θ.
-
Importance: This identity allows you to calculate the tangent of an angle if you know its sine and cosine. It's also crucial for simplifying trigonometric expressions and solving trigonometric equations.

Other Related Identities (For Context): While the core answer is above, here are other related trigonometric identities:
- Reciprocal Identities:
- cot θ = 1 / tan θ = cos θ / sin θ
- Pythagorean Identities: These link sine, cosine, and tangent indirectly:
- sin² θ + cos² θ = 1
- 1 + tan² θ = sec² θ
- 1 + cot² θ = csc² θ
